Installare eeeXubuntu su penna usb per EeePc..Senza lettore.

Installare eeeXubuntu su penna usb per EeePc..In modo persistente,quindi mantenendo personalizzato il nostro sistema..Senza bisogno di lettore CD esterno usb..

È possibile installare eeeXubuntu su una periferica USB (pen drive, hard disk esterno, etc) in modalità persistente. Ciò significa che sarà possibile avviare il sistema da tale periferica mantenendo le personalizzazioni come il layout della tastiera, le preferenze e i pacchetti installati. Occorre un dispositivo USB da almeno 1 Gb di memoria: 700 Mb verranno occupati dai file necessari al funzionamento del sistema, lo spazio restante rimarrà a disposizione dell’utente.
Tutte le operazioni verranno fatte da un pc(non eeePc)con linux installato..

OCCORRENTE:
• Disporre di una PC con sistema linux sopra(Con cui verrano fatte tutte le operazioni sotto elencate)
• Disporre di un cd di eeeXubuntu o di un immagine. Iso procurabile qui http://wiki.eeeuser.com/ubuntu:eeexubuntu:home.
PREMESSA: IO SUPPONGO CHE I DISCHI VENGANO MONTATI IN “media”,E CHE IL NOME ASSEGNATO PER LA PENNA USB SIA “sda”…

Per conoscere il nome assegnato dal sistema alla periferica,aprire una finestra di terminale e digitare il seguente comando:

sudo fdisk –l

Una volta identificata la periferica è necessario creare al suo interno due partizioni: la prima, necessaria al corretto funzionamento del sistema, dovrà avere delle dimensioni pari almeno a 700 MB, la seconda, invece, potrà tranquillamente occupare tutto il resto dello spazio disponibile.
Aprire un terminale e digitare il seguente comando:

sudo umount /dev/sda1

Creiamo le partizioni.
Eseguiamo fdisk sul dispositivo sda(nel mio caso), digitare il seguente comando:

sudo fdisk /dev/sda

Dovrebbe apparire la riga di comando di fdisk. Per visualizzare la tabella delle partizioni corrente è utile premere il tasto «p»; prima di proseguire è necessario rimuovere tutte le partizioni presenti nella periferica: a tale scopo è sufficiente premere il tasto «d» seguito dal numero della partizione da eliminare.

Una volta eliminate tutte le partizioni date i seguenti comandi:
• n per creare una nuova partizione
• p per renderla primaria
• 1 così dite che è la prima
• accettate il valore di default
• +750M per creare la partizione da 750 mega
• a per rendere la partizione attiva
• 1 per indicare che è la prima partizione
• t per cambiare il tipo di partizione
• 6 per impostare FAT16 come tipo di partizione
La prima partizione è impostata. Ora seguiamo con la seconda:
• n per creare una nuova partizione
• p per renderla primaria
• 2 così dite che è la seconda
• accettate il valore di default
• accettate il valore di default per rendere la partizione il piu’ grande possibile
• In fine premere w per scrivere i cambiamenti nella pendrive
Formattiamo le partizioni
La prima partizione Io la chiamo xubuntu ma voi potete fare a vostro piacimento,invece la seconda deve essere per forza chiamata casper-rw..
Date i comandi

sudo mkfs.vfat -F 16 -n xubuntu /dev/sdb1

sudo mkfs.ext2 -b 4096 -L casper-rw /dev/sdb2

Per montare le partizioni è sufficiente estrarre e reinserire il dispositivo nella porta USB.

(Nel caso che il sistema non monti automaticamente le partizioni presenti nella periferica verificare le impostazioni presenti in Sistema -> Preferenze -> Unità e supporti removibili, oppure digitare i seguenti comandi:

sudo mount /dev/sda1 /media/unpuntodimount1

sudo mount /dev/sda2 /media/unpuntodimount2

nstalliamo…

Nel caso decidete di non masterizzare l’immagine di eeeXubuntu,la possiamo motare in una cartella, quindi:

mkdir ubuntuCD

sudo mount ubuntu-6.10-desktop-i386.iso ubuntuCD -o loop

Quelli che seguono sono gli elenchi dei file e delle cartelle presenti nel CD che andranno copiati all’interno della prima partizione creata in precedenza:
Cartelle :
• casper
• dists
• install
• pool
• preseed
• .disk
File :
• isolinux/*
• README.diskdefines

La cartella isolinux non va copiata sul dispositivo, ma il suo contenuto va copiato direttamente nella radice / della prima partizione del dispositivo.
Per finire, non resta che rinominare il file che si trova ora nella nostra penna usb isolinux.cfg in syslinux.cfg.

La copia file via comando:

cd ubuntuCD

cp -rf casper /media/xubuntu

cp -rf dists /media/xubuntu

cp -rf install /media/xubuntu

cp -rf pool /media/xubuntu

cp -rf preseed /media/xubuntu

cp -rf .disk /media/xubuntu

cp isolinux/* /media/xubuntu

cp README.diskdefines /media/xubuntu

cd /media/xubuntu

mv isolinux.cfg syslinux.cfg

Rendere il dispositivo avviabile
Affinchè il sistema possa venire caricato dalla periferica USB è necessario installare un bootloader. Per tali operazioni è stato scelto syslinux, un bootloader leggero e semplice da configurare.
Configurazione di syslinux
Andate nella nella pendrive è modificate il file syslinux.cfg,Via comando:

sudo gedit /media/xubuntu/syslinux.cfg

Cancellate tutto il suo contenuto e inserite:

DEFAULT custom
GFXBOOT bootlogo
GFXBOOT-ACCESS-OPTIONS v1 v2 m1
APPEND  preseed/file=preseed/xubuntu.seed boot=casper initrd=/casper/initrd.gz root=/dev/ram  quiet splash locale=it_IT bootkbd=it console-setup/layoutcode=it console-setup/variantcode=nodeadkeys --
LABEL custom
menu label ^Avvia Xubuntu in modo persistente
kernel /casper/vmlinuz
append  preseed/file=preseed/xubuntu.seed boot=casper persistent  initrd=/casper/initrd.gz root=/dev/ram rw  quiet splash locale=it_IT --
LABEL live
menu label Avvia o ^installa Xubuntu
kernel /casper/vmlinuz
append  preseed/file=preseed/xubuntu.seed boot=casper initrd=/casper/initrd.gz root=/dev/ram rw  quiet splash --
LABEL xforcevesa
menu label Avvia Xubuntu in modalità ^grafica sicura
kernel /casper/vmlinuz
append  file=/cdrom/preseed/xubuntu.seed boot=casper xforcevesa initrd=/casper/initrd.gz root=/dev/ram rw  quiet splash --
LABEL oem
menu label Installazione ^OEM ( per assemblatori )
kernel /casper/vmlinuz
append  file=/cdrom/preseed/xubuntu.seed boot=casper oem-config/enable=true initrd=/casper/initrd.gz root=/dev/ram rw  quiet splash --
LABEL check
menu label ^Controlla difetti sul dispositivo
kernel /casper/vmlinuz
append  boot=casper integrity-check initrd=/casper/initrd.gz root=/dev/ram rw quiet splash --
LABEL memtest
menu label ^Test della memoria RAM
kernel /install/mt86plus
append -
LABEL hd
menu label ^Boot dal primo Hard Disk
localboot 0x80
append -
DISPLAY isolinux.txt
TIMEOUT 300
PROMPT 1
F1 f1.txt
F2 f2.txt
F3 f3.txt
F4 f4.txt
F5 f5.txt
F6 f6.txt
F7 f7.txt
F8 f8.txt
F9 f9.txt
F0 f10.txt

Ora bisogna solo rendere avviabile la chiavetta USB.
Rendere avviabile la chiavetta USB
Installiamo due pacchetti che servono allo scopo

sudo apt-get install syslinux mtools

Rendiamo avviabile la chiavetta con:

sudo umount /tmp/liveusb

sudo syslinux -f /dev/sdb1

Finito!
Abilitare il Boot da chiavetta Usb dal nostro eeePc.
A eeepc spento inseriamo la nostra penna usb,
Entriamo nel bios (Quando avviamo l’eee, alla comparsa della schermata di avvio,premere F2)..
Spostandoci con le frecce direzionali, andiamo su Boot>Hard Disk Drives <invio>
In “1sd Drive” sostituire ADD:SM_SILICONMOTION con USB:”xxxxxxx”
<invio>
F10 <invio>
Avviooooooooooooooooooooooooo
A sistema avviato….
Sistemare l’audio..
Cliccate col destro in basso alla barra.
Premete Aggiungi Nuova Applet
Cercare il Volume Control e aggiungetelo
In “Device”, scegliete ”#0: HDA Intel”
Lasciate “xfc4-mixer”

Sistemare i tasti per il controllo volume,luminosità,standby,ecc..
Scaricare il file da quì http://in.solit.us/archives/download/139438..
Andiamo nella cartella dove e stato salvato,quindi:

cd /”cartella”

tar xvfz eeexubuntu-osd.tar.gz

cd eeexubuntu-osd

sudo ./install.sh

Per problemi o per opinioni dite pure..

Nessun Commento »

Puoi lasciare una risposta, oppure fare un trackback dal tuo sito.


Vuoi essere il primo a lasciare un commento per questo articolo? Utilizza il modulo sotto..

Lascia un commento




Il tuo commento:

dippiù?